The invention aims at providing a pressure control method applied to the redundant brake system, after brake fluid in a pressure cavity is discharged by a pressure release valve in a wheel end adjusting unit, the discharged brake fluid is supplemented by controlling the flow of a second pressure generating unit; meanwhile, a first pressure generation unit is matched with the flow generated by the second pressure generation unit and the flow needed by wheel end pressure control, piston position control is conducted to guarantee that the pressure in a brake fluid channel is stable, the piston position in the first pressure generation unit is controlled, and the situation that the piston position is too front or too rear and incapability of voltage buildup or incapability of linear voltage buildup is caused is avoided.
